Output 1ddf8ed5d2cdbed2f76c89223290ba618fc05d2584209390a43fc764b11bc6c1:11

value
10431970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d859238d1a50e1f5490e34c919f26506454aa8 OP_EQUAL
address
3GSmtZiLeBKRZ9hYqLqoAqReXn14x3JX2W
transaction
1ddf8ed5d2cdbed2f76c89223290ba618fc05d2584209390a43fc764b11bc6c1
spent
true